Join our amazing team as a Before & After School Care Counselor. This position has flexible scheduling, no weekend hours, a fun working environment and offers great experiences working with children! Counselors lead a group of children through activities before and after school during 2025-2026 school year at a local elementary school in Northbrook School District 27, Northbrook/Glenview School District 30 and West Northfield School District 31.

This position runs through June 2026 with opportunities for employment as a summer camp counselor and continued employment during the 2026-2027 school year.

Pay & Schedule:
$15.00 - $20.00 Per Hour (DOQ)

This is a part-time seasonal, non-exempt position.

7:00 AM - 8:45 AM or 2:15 PM, 2:45 PM, 3:00 PM, or 3:30 PM - 6:00 PM

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Supervises a group of children, 5‐12 years of age, throughout daily activities.
  • Closely monitors morning drop‐off and afternoon sign‐off process (attendance).
  • Diligently plans and implements daily activities, both active and passive, in the areas determined by the Site Director.
  • Actively provides campers with a positive camp experience while monitoring the care and safety of each child through active participation in all aspects of the program. Activities include but are not limited to sports, games, arts and crafts, swimming (summer camp), schoolwork (Adventure Campus), and field trips.
  • Professionally acts as liaison between the parents, children and Site Director in a courteous and positive manner.
  • Diligently follows and adheres to all safety policies and procedures, policies set forth in the Employee Handbook and other program manuals, policies, and procedures issued by the Northbrook Park District.
  • Routinely keeps the program site neat and clean and all equipment and supplies in good order.
  • Participates in staff meetings and all orientation and training sessions.
  • Routinely assists with implementing severe weather and crises management procedures when needed.
  • Wears a Northbrook Park District staff uniform at all times when on duty.
  • Collaborates with internal and external customers in a positive manner.
  • Follows safe work practices.
  • Attends trainings and meetings as required.
  • Performs related duties as assigned.

Must be at least 16 years of age and have some experience working hands‐on with children; or any equivalent combination of training and experience which provides the following knowledge, ability and skills.

Skills & Abilities

  • Work well with children, parents and Park District staff

  • Communicate effectively both orally and in writing

  • Become CPR and AED Certified

Knowledge

  • Hands‐on experience working with children

  • District safety policies and procedures

  • Recreational activities to include sports, games, arts and crafts, music, dance, swimming (Summer camp/field trips)

Physical Requirements

The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

  • Work is performed in both an indoor and outdoor setting. Employee may be exposed to cold or warm temperatures and to quick changes in temperatures. The employee may work outdoors in varying weather conditions.

  • While performing the duties of this job the employee frequently is required to sit or stand for long periods of time.

  • The employee is required to talk or hear; use hands and fingers to handle, feel, or operate objects, tools, or controls; and reach with hands and arms.

  • The employee is required to walk; sit; climb or balance; stoop, kneel, couch, or crawl; and smell.

  • The employee must occasionally lift and/or move up to 50 pounds. Employee is allowed and encouraged to use manual assists for lifting above 40 lbs. as a guideline. Working in teams will also allow workers to have assistance with heavier activities at various sites.

  • Specific vision abilities required by this job includes close vision and the ability to adjust focus.
